javascript - 使用 "\n"字符在javascript中创建换行符

标签 javascript html

我正在用 javascript 编写一个非常基本的代码,我期待使用 "\n"对于换行符,但它似乎不起作用。

我在其他帖子中看到了替代解决方案,但我想知道为什么是 "\n"不在这里工作。

这是我的代码。

<html>

<body>
    <h2>welcome to java script</h2>
    <script>
        var x = 10;
        var y = 20;
        var sum = x + y;
        var mult = x * y;
        document.write("the sum is " + sum);
        document.write("\n");
        document.write(" the product is " + mult);
    </script>
</body>

</html>

最佳答案

换行符 ( \n ) 在不在文档中的字符串中换行。

要在文档中换行,您必须使用 HTML <br/>元素。

<html>

<body>
    <h2>welcome to java script</h2>
    <script>
        var x = 10;
        var y = 20;
        var sum = x + y;
        var mult = x * y;
        document.write("the sum is " + sum);
        document.write("<br/>");
        document.write(" the product is " + mult);
    </script>
</body>

</html>

关于javascript - 使用 "\n"字符在javascript中创建换行符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59871752/

相关文章:

javascript - 有条件地响应渲染

html - 不同设备底部的按钮组

javascript - 单击动态更改的元素上的按钮

javascript - this.focus() 在 Firefox 中无法正常工作

javascript - 每次更新文本字段值

javascript - 当没有更多带有 Bootstrap 的元素时隐藏 slider 轮播按钮

html - CSS3 boxshadow 在所有其他元素之上?

javascript - 在javascript中构建层次结构树

c# - 从客户端调用代码隐藏(安全页面)中的方法(JavaScript)

javascript - TouchEvent 在 Firefox 和其他网站浏览器中不起作用